What Is Self Care In Nursing?

by
Last updated on 4 min read

Self-care is any deliberate activity that we do to provide for our physical, mental, and spiritual well-being . ... Self-care reduces stress, replenishes a nurse’s capacity to provide compassion and empathy, and improves the quality of care. It’s also recommended by the American Nurses Association in its Code of Ethics.

What is self-care in Healthcare?

Included in the World Health Organization’s definition of self-care is “ the ability of individuals, families and communities to promote health, prevent disease, maintain health, and cope with illness and disability with or without the support of a health-care provider .”

What are the four categories of self-care?

Self-care includes all the things you do to take care of your well-being in four key dimensions – your emotional, physical, psychological, and spiritual health .

What happens if you don’t do self-care?

Neglecting personal care can cause increases in anxiety, distractibility, anger, and fatigue . You may also experience decreases in sleep, relationship satisfaction, self-esteem, empathy, and compassion.
